The Study of pH Effects on Phase Transition of Multi-Stimuli Responsive P(NiPAAm-co-AAc) Hydrogel Using 2D-COS

Abstract: The temperature and mechanism of phase transition of poly(N-isopropylacrylamide-co-acrylic acid) [P(NiPAAm-co-AAc)], which is one of the multi-stimuli responsive polymers, were investigated at various pHs using infrared (IR) spectroscopy, two-dimensional (2D) gradient mapping, and two-dimensional correlation spectroscopy (2D-COS). The determined phase transition temperature of P(NiPAAm-co-AAc) at pH 4, 3, and 2 based on 2D gradient mapping and principal component analysis (PCA) showed that it decreases with de… Show more

“…In 2D-COS, a group of spectra, obtained under some form of perturbation on the sample, are converted into a correlation intensity plot defined by two independent spectral variable axes. During the past three decades, 2D-COS has attracted extensive interest and numerous publications have been accumulated. Many subtle spectral variations, not readily observed in original spectra, can be revealed via the characteristic cross-peaks in the corresponding 2D correlation spectra. Especially, 2D-COS provides a promising chance to investigate intermolecular interactions.…”

“…In the meantime, this hydrogel has been reported with various properties when it is co-polymerized with other materials that provide PNIPAM with additional properties. For example, acrylic acid is commonly used as a co-polymer with PNIPAM making the hydrogel pH-responsive [ 38 , 39 , 40 , 41 ]. Moreover, introducing nanoparticles (e.g., gold and ferroferric oxide) into the PNIPAM polymer matrix will make them light-responsive through a photothermal effect when it is exposed to lights with a corresponding wavelength [ 42 , 43 , 44 , 45 ].…”
